索引器 原创 AspNetEye 2010-01-01 22:22:57 博主文章分类:C# ©著作权 文章标签 职场 休闲 索引器 文章分类 .Net 后端开发 ©著作权归作者所有:来自51CTO博客作者AspNetEye的原创作品,请联系作者获取转载授权,否则将追究法律责任 索引器:为数组创建索引器后,可以通过从类对象指定索引来直接访问数组元素1.可以用索引数组的方式索引对象。2.可以像访问数组一样访问类的成员索引器的规则:1.必须指定至少一个索引器参数2.应当为索引器参数赋值3.可以指定多个索引器参数 索引器与数组的比较:1.索引器不指向内存位置2.索引器可以有非整数的小标(索引)3.索引器可以重载 赞 收藏 评论 分享 举报 上一篇:值类型与引用类型 下一篇:控制台代码心得 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 MySQL 8.0索引合并 - 优化器如何处理OR条件查询? 在MySQL 8.0中,优化器对OR条件查询的处理逻辑有了显著的改进,特别是在索引合并方面。背景在MySQL 5.7中,对于以下查询:select * from t1 where cid=3 or info='ccc';优化器无法有效利用索引,因为OR条件查询通常会导致全表扫描,特别是当两个条件分别使用不同的索引时。MySQL 8.0中的改进在MySQL 8.0中,优化器引入了索引合并(Index ci MySQL 主键 SQL索引 SQL 索引的工作原理SQL 索引类似于书籍的目录,帮助数据库快速定位数据。在没有索引的情况下,数据库会进行全表扫描,逐行查找所需数据,这在数据量大时非常耗时。而有了索引,数据库可以使用类似于二叉树的数据结构快速查找。行平衡。哈希索引: 适用于等值查询,但不适合范围查询。它通过哈希表进行索引查找。全文索引: 主要用于处理文本搜索,可以在较大文本字段中执行查找操作。索引的创建与使用1. 创建单列索引 SQL 全文索引 数据库 索引技术总结 整体分类HashLinear Hashing线性哈希 可以动态扩容多维哈希 Multi-dimensional Hashing (mah)有序索引B+TreeB+Tree的一个节点就是一个Page, 一个Page内可以存多达500个值索引和数据的读取都以Page为单位LSM-tree跳表基于签名的索引 Signature-based Indexing因为 索引 C#索引器-索引器的定义 索引器定义类似于属性,但其功能与属性并不相同。索引器提供一种特殊的方法编写get和set访问器。属性可以像访问字段一样访问对象的数据,索引器可以使用户像访问数组一样访问类成员。定义索引器的语法如下:<访问修饰符> 类型名称 this [类型名称 参数名]{ get{//获得属性的代码} set{ //设置属性的代码}}索引器没有像属性和方法那样的名字,关键字this清楚地表达了索引器引 c# 索引器 数组 数据类型 索引器&集合 索引器&集合配合使用,实现使用[]获取数据的目的 示例代码 "IndexerAndCollection" 索引器 集合 认识索引器 索引器的基础就不多说了,主要就是用对象加下标来获取对象内的私有序列数据。下面看这样一个类: class MyClass { string[] StrArr = new string[] { "a&quo 职场 休闲 Windows Phone 7 java 索引器 # Java 索引器的实现## 简介索引器是一种常见的数据结构,用于提高对数据集合的检索效率。在 Java 中,我们可以使用哈希表或树等数据结构来实现索引器。本文将介绍如何使用 Java 实现一个简单的索引器。## 索引器实现步骤下面是实现索引器的步骤概览:| 步骤 | 描述 || --- | --- || 步骤 1 | 定义索引器的数据结构 || 步骤 2 | 添加元素到 索引器 java 数据结构 python 索引器 # Python 索引器详解:使用索引提取数据在 Python 中,数据结构如列表、元组、字符串等都是有序的,它们的每个元素都有一个相应的索引。利用这些索引,我们可以方便地访问和操作数据。本文将带您深入了解 Python 中的索引器,结合具体的代码示例和实际应用场景,加深您对这一概念的理解。## 什么是索引器?索引器是指用于获取数据结构中元素的工具。在 Python 中,索引通常从 0 索引器 Python 数据结构 windows 索引器 windows索引器索引区域设置 windows索引服务是windows操作系统提供的桌面搜索引擎,通过预先创建索引来提高对硬盘上文件内容的搜索速度。以windows服务程序的方式运行。一、工作方式1、对指定路径下的文件创建索引,并生成索引文件,索引文件的路径可以指定。2、使用时,根据索引文件进行查询,不需要再次打开被索引的文件二、使用方式1、可以在windows搜索文件内容的时候指定使用索引服务,可以提高搜索速度。2 windows 索引器 操作系统 运维 java 搜索 索引器 using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Collections; namespace Test2 { //索引器允许类或结构的实例就像数组一样进行索引。索引器类似于属性... C#基础 索引器 数组 i++ 抛出异常 C#索引器-索引器概述 数组中的元素可以通过索引进行检索,如果一个类中有很多对象,怎样简单、快速地查找到需要的对象以及对象的特性呢?索引器就是为了实现这样的功能而设计的。索引器允许类或结构的实例按照与数组相同的方式进行索引。可以简单地把索引器理解为书中的目录,字典中提供的检索的索引。索引器(Indexer)是C#引入的一个新型的类成员,它使得对象可以像数组那样被方便,直观的引用。索引器非常类似于我们前面讲到的属性,但索引器可以有参数列表,且只能作用在实例对象上,而不能在类上直接作用。索引器可以重载,以数组的形式访问类中的成员,实际上不单单是访问,可以在访问的代码中实现特定的处理。 索引器 数组 c# 类成员 C 索引器indexer 一、索引器的基本概述 索引器定义类似于属性,但其功能与属性并不相同,可以看成是属性的增强版,它能够让对象以类似数组的方式来存取,使程序看起来更为直观,更容易编写。1、索引器的定义定义的一般形式:[修饰符] 数据类型this[索引类型 index]{ get{//获得属性的代码} set{ //设置属性的代码}}修饰符包括public,protected,private,internal,new,virtual,sealed,override, abstract,extern.this关键字用于定义索引器。this表示操作本对象的数组或集合成员,可以简单把它理解成索引器的名字,因此索引器不能具有 索引器 数组 修饰符 按序 数据类型 wpf索引器 将公式快速向下填充鼠标指向已添加公式单元格右下角,当出现+号时,鼠标双击锁定被统计公式单元格=A1*A2,点击A2按F4快速改变数据格式Ctrl+Shift+4 快速将1改变为¥1 Ctrl+Shift+5 快速将1改变为10%快速跳转Ctrl+↑ 跳转至顶部 Ctrl+↓ 跳转至底部 wpf索引器 数据 数据源 快捷键 win 索引器 由于coreseek官网已经消失拉,coreseek包我使用其他方式下载下来coreseek-3.2.14-win32.zip这个包;(百度的话还是能搜索到不少人共享的地址的)或者以互联网形式找到此压缩包安装开始;首先将coreseek-3.2.14-win32.zip打开解压(自行补图):我是直接解压到D盘里面的:由于开源产品coreseek 在windows上无需安装只需要放在某个目录下即可咱 win 索引器 sql sphinx php window索引器 使用索引器使用索引器,以数组风格访问对象声明get accessor控制索引器读取访问声明set accessor控制索引器写入访问在接口中声明索引器在从接口继承的结构和类中实现索引器引言类(结构)成员可以有很多,当用不同类型的单个私有字段时,用属性解决封装与隐藏问题——很好。但当类中的字段是一个数组时,会出现问题在程序中写如下语句较另人费解 &nbs window索引器 c# 索引器 数组 字段 labviewindex索引器 前面介绍了如何熟悉和使用Labview自带的库函数以及调试方式,大家后期基本可以凭借这两个方式从入门到出家了,哈哈,后面就靠各位同仁99%的努力了。这篇为啥要讲移位寄存器呢,主要是之前做的项目和经验告诉我,移位寄存器是个好东西,用得好,代码量可以更加有效简洁。老曹目前的程序基本就没脱开过移位寄存器的使用。下面就简单的讲解一下移位寄存器的使用,各 labviewindex索引器 labview 数组 移位寄存器 状态机 迭代器索引 一、迭代器 迭代器(iterator):扮演容器与算法之间的胶合剂,是所谓的“泛型指针”。 迭代器模式:提供一种方法,使之能够依序寻访某个聚合物(容器)所含的各个元素,而又无需暴露该聚合物的内部表达方式。 STL的中心思想在于:将数据容器和算法分开,彼此独立设计,最后再以一贴胶着剂(iterator)将它们撮合在一起。 迭代器iterator 提供了一种一般化的方法对顺序或关联容器类型中的 迭代器索引 迭代器 数据 容器类 硬盘索引器 。此人讲解十分清楚,唯一缺点是印度英语口音不好辨识。学习B树和B+树,需要从以下几方面来理解,直接上来整定义,很难懂。知识点如下:1. 磁盘结构2. 数据如何在磁盘中存储3. 什么是索引4. 什么是多级索引5. m-way搜索树(二叉搜索树BST的推广)6. B树7. B树的插入和删除8. B+树 一、磁盘结构磁盘(硬盘)中存储介质是圆形的,类似光盘。数据记录在这些圆盘上(别 硬盘索引器 数据 搜索树 多级 java 索引数组 java 索引器 注意:Lucene中的一些比较复杂的词法分析是用JavaCC生成的(JavaCC:Java Compiler Compiler,纯JAVA的词法分析生成器),所以如果从源代码编译或需要修改其中的QueryParser、定制自己的词法分析器,还需要从http://www.webgain.com/products/java_cc/下载javacc。lucene的组成结构:对于外部应用来说索引模块(in java 索引数组 全文索引JAVA 字段 apache 搜索 java集合索引 java 索引器 Solr简介 solr是Apache下的一个顶级开源项目,采用Java开发,它是基于Lucene的全文检索服务,solr可以独立运行在Jetty\Tomcat\Servlet容器中 使用Solr进行创建索引和搜索索引的实现方法很简单创建索引:客户端(可以是浏览器可以是Java程序)用POST方法向solr服务器发送一个描述Field及其内容的XML文档,Solr服务器根据xml文档添加,删除,更新 java集合索引 SSM 全文检索 Solr ElasticSearch